The Allure of Backyard Wrestling 2
Backyard Wrestling 2: There Goes the Neighborhood, released in 2004, was a sequel that built upon the foundation laid by its predecessor. The game was developed by Eidos Interactive and was available on the PlayStation 2 and Xbox. It distinguished itself with its over-the-top violence, a roster of memorable characters, and a focus on backyard environments. Platforms and Versions
Knowing the platforms and versions of the game is essential when determining its value and availability. Backyard Wrestling 2 was primarily released on the following platforms: (See Also: How Is Wrestling Staged )
- PlayStation 2 (PS2): This was the most common platform for the game, and finding a PS2 copy is generally easier than finding the Xbox version.
- Xbox: The Xbox version is typically rarer, which can impact its price.
There weren’t significant differences between the PS2 and Xbox versions, although some subtle graphical and performance variations might exist. In terms of versions, there weren’t any special editions or re-releases of Backyard Wrestling 2. The standard retail version is what you’ll be looking for.
Factors Influencing Price
Several factors can influence the price of Backyard Wrestling 2, making it a fluctuating market. Understanding these elements can help you make an informed purchase.
- Condition of the game: This is perhaps the most significant factor. A game in mint condition, with the original case, artwork, and manual, will command a higher price than a loose disc.
- Completeness: Is the game complete with the case, manual, and any inserts? A complete game is more valuable than a disc-only purchase.
- Rarity: The Xbox version is generally rarer than the PS2 version. Consequently, the Xbox version often sells for more.
- Demand: The game’s popularity among collectors and enthusiasts can influence its price. If there’s high demand, prices tend to increase.
- Seller: Where you buy the game matters. Retailers, online marketplaces, and private sellers all have different pricing strategies.

Pricing Guide: What to Expect
The price of Backyard Wrestling 2 can vary considerably. Here’s a general idea of what to expect: (See Also: Is Carmella Coming Back To Wrestling )
| Condition | Platform | Price Range (USD) |
|---|---|---|
| Loose Disc | PS2 | $5 – $15 |
| Complete in Box (CIB) | PS2 | $15 – $30 |
| Loose Disc | Xbox | $10 – $25 |
| Complete in Box (CIB) | Xbox | $25 – $50+ |
Important Note: These are estimates, and prices can fluctuate. Factors like the seller’s reputation, shipping costs, and current market trends can influence the final price.
